12 Team Round Robin Schedule

Large single-group round robin — 66 games, six matches per round, best split across pools or multiple days.

Twelve teams in one round robin group means every team plays 11 games and the event runs 66 matches total. That is a league-scale commitment — realistic on four or more courts over a weekend, or as a season-long schedule. Many organizers at 12 teams choose two pools of six instead.

Pool play alternative

Two pools of 6 → 30 games (15 per pool) plus knockout among top teams — often 20–25 fewer games than a full 12-team round robin.

Three pools of 4 → 18 pool games — fastest for a single weekend if you only need to rank qualifiers.

Venue math

Six simultaneous games need six courts and six officials. With two courts, each round runs three waves — 33 time slots minimum before breaks.

Tie-breakers at scale

Large tables almost always need goal difference after points. Publish the full tie-breaker hierarchy — head-to-head among three or more tied teams gets complex quickly.

FAQ

Is 12 teams feasible in one day?

Only with very short matches and many courts. Most 12-team events span two days or use pools.

Double round robin for 12 teams?

132 games — a full home-and-away league season, not a cup format.

How does this compare to 10 teams?

Ten teams need 45 games. Twelve adds 21 more matches — plan capacity before expanding registration.
